This is an AI-generated tattoo project concept. The grayscale composition centers on a couple in formal attire standing close on a sweeping staircase, sheltered by an umbrella, while a large female face rises from wispy clouds behind them. The scene is rendered in black and grey with meticulous shading, soft transitions, and fine line work that define textures—from the satin of the dress to the stone of the staircase and the fabric of the umbrella. The staircase curves upward in a diagonal plane, guiding the eye toward the couple and the ethereal portrait, while ornate lamp posts anchor the composition and add a vintage, cinematic aura. Symbolically, the image blends romance, ascent, and memory: the embrace suggests connection, the upward stairs imply a journey or turning point, and the face in the clouds can be read as a protective or guiding presence. The concept is suitable for a tattoo design in a realistic black-and-grey style, with potential to be adapted as a fine-line tattoo for smaller canvases or expanded into a larger piece on the back or chest. Because of its heavy tonal contrast and covered shadows, this concept also functions well as a cover-up, where darker rails and shadows can mask older ink while the lighter faces and cloud forms provide breathing space. In practice, an artist could refine line weight, adjust proportions to the body area, and tailor the umbrella and lamp post motifs to harmonize with muscular or skeletal landmarks.
